The Student Math League was founded in 1970 by Nassau Community College in New York. In 1981, the American Mathematical Association of Two-Year Colleges (AMATYC) began sponsoring the competition. Today the League has grown to more than 165 colleges in more than thirty-five states involving over eight thousand community college math students.
The Student Math League is a contest consisting of two one-hour exams. The first exam is given in the fall and the second in the spring. Each exam consists of 20 multiple choice questions covering precalculus material (e.g. algebra, geometry, trigonometry, and statistics). The top 5 competitors from the fall and spring rounds represent Ventura College as a team in the national competition. Please click here for more information on the competition.
